WebOct 3, 2024 · Report Foreign Bank and Financial Accounts. Who Must File the FBAR? A United States person that has a financial interest in or signature authority over foreign financial accounts must file an FBAR if the aggregate value of the foreign financial accounts exceeds $10,000 at any time during the calendar year. WebAccounts Jointly Owned by Spouses (see exceptions in the FBAR instructions) If the account owner is filing an FBAR jointly with his/her spouse, the spouse must also complete Part I, items 4 through 6. The spouse must also sign and date the report in items 11/12, (item 11 may be digitally signed) and complete items 13 and 14. WebForm 114a - Record of Authorization to Electronically File FBARs is the FinCEN signature authrozation document. This form gives a third party authorization to electronically submit the FBAR - Form 114 on the taxpayers behalf. A separate Form 114a will be produced for each Form 114 that is electronically filed Solution Tools Attachments

WebTo file the FBAR as an individual, you must personally and/or jointly own a reportable foreign financial account that requires the filing of an FBAR (FinCEN Report 114) for the reportable year. There is no need to register to file the FBAR as an individual.
